No big surprise, I would say.

Stockfish has no special opening knowledge (except for the PSTs),
and is known to do better with a decent opening book.

Stockfish's opening analysis is horrendous. Even deep into openings, it'll believe moves that do nothing are best. This is specially true for obscure openings where not much analysis or books are available (I still remember the first time I played against the Sokolsky in a correspondence game against much weaker opponent, I was struggling hard because I wasn't prepared and all engine's analysis turned out to be poor.)

But this is great! Opening analysis is the last fun thing remaining in computer chess, there's a point in a game where today's engines easily find the best move (that can't be improved with more depth) and at that point the game has been decided. This point has been approaching the opening, but it's still far away enough, that human intervention and move choice in the opening remains critical.

I am disappointed, I was wondering if it made sense SF could build an opening book by itself using Multi-PV. First results (analysis time 100ms) looked promising 48.3% against the ProDeo book, 49.4% (analysis time 1000ms), now trying 2000ms but I think I am wasting my time looking at the moves it sometimes produces. Was hoping for a bug that could be fixed but looking at the responses that's unlikely.
